  • The driver initialization is complete, but no sound is played, so this appears to be a general amplifier bring-up issue. Could you check the register dump of the MAX98388, chip power supply, and the audio format of the I2S master.  You need to ensure the digital audio provided by the audio master conforms to the configuration set in the MAX98388.

    I can help with this if you like, but I'll need the following:

    • Digital audio master configuration.  This includes, but not limited to Format (I2S, TDM, etc.), sample rate, bit depth per channel, number of channels)
    • Provide a MAX98388 register dump.  If you provide all register writes you're making , I can confirm if it correctly matches the supplied digital audio.
    • Provide a scope measurement of the digital audio master output.  This includes BCLK, LRCLK, and DIN.  The scope should be triggered on LRCLK so I can decode the frame properly.  From this, I can compare the digital audio to your desired setting and ensure it matches.

    More things to verify:

    • Double check the hardware enable pin to make certain the device is not in hardware shutdown.
    • Confirm all power supplies are provided and match EC table values.

    I checked my I2S signal. The I2S signal sent by my microprocessor is at 3.3V whereas it should be at 1.8V.
